Unexpected. A Memoir of Endurance and Triumph in Raising a Challenging Child
Product Description
▼▲Has your life gone as planned, or have there been surprising challenges along the way? This inspiring memoir tells of an adoption that took the Parkers down an unexpected journey as their daughter was diagnosed with ADHD and ODD, then Asperger's and finally, bipolar disorder. The only way to endure those years was to take life one day at a time and ask God for strength and wisdom. After years of frustration, their prayers were answered in miraculous ways. If you're in a similar situation, know that a happy ending may be possible for you, too. Do you believe it?

As a social worker professor, counselor and a parent, I believe Maralee Parker's debut memoir, Unexpected, is one of the most important books to come along in years. This easy-to-read and very relatable book details the struggles Parker and her husband faced raising their adopted daughter Beth (now an adult), who experienced a range of difficult behavioral crises throughout her childhood. Parker details the challenges she faced as a mother who dearly wanted to love a child who seemed incapable of loving her back, challenges with other parents' well-meaning but often unhelpful and even shaming advice, and challenges to her faith life when prayer alone did not seem to be enough. Parker's readable and relatable memoir provides parents (and really anyone) with sage wisdom rooted in her Christian faith in a way that goes beyond common anecdotes and superficial answers. Parker provides struggling parents and family members with guidance in how to love a difficult child who may seem unlovable. But the lessons Parker provides extend beyond parenting and can be applied to any crisis that makes us question our faith in God and in ourselves. I plan on providing this book to every one of my clients who is struggling with family issues, particularly parenting challenges. - Michelle Martin, PhD, MSW. Associate Professor of Social Work, California State University, Fullerton

Tell us a little about yourself. I'm a wife of one, mom of two, grandma of three; and a lover of dachshunds, coffee, and birdwatching. Retirement is a happy chapter in my life!
What was your motivation behind this project? I wrote this book because I knew God had a plan for our years of "unexpected" pain. He wanted me to use my writing skill to let others know they are not alone in their difficult journey of raising a child with disabilities.
What do you hope folks will gain from this project? I pray that those in the trenches will find encouragement and hope in my book. I want them to know there may be a brighter future around the corner, one that they are not expecting! I also pray that those who have no clue will become more educated about the challenges others face, and thus, more compassionate.
How were you personally impacted by working on this project? It was difficult to relive the difficult events over and over again, as I wrote and rewrote, edited and re-edited. Yet, it also brought me to thank and worship my Lord, who directed our lives, for His purposes, throughout the difficult years. He continues to do so day by day.
Who are your influences, sources of inspiration or favorite authors / artists? Rick and Kay Warren are a couple I highly respect, knowing that they lost their son to suicide. They have responded to their pain by developing resources for others who are walking the path they walked. They are serving God in a ministry that is so greatly needed. I thank God for them.
Anything else you'd like readers / listeners to know: One simple lesson I've learned throughout my life, and especially with raising our Beth, is to take it all one day at a time. Don't worry about tomorrow or next week, month, or year. Each day has enough trouble of its own, as Matthew 6:34 tells us. Beth and I went and got matching tattoos with that phrase, "One Day at a Time." I try to apply it. Daily. :)
